Post by: allinvain on December 08, 2013, 09:27:37 AM
I'm thinking of purchasing a few extenders from you. However first I'd like to put on a slightly technical question out there. I read on a different thread that some motherboards require shorting of the pins on these extenders when using the 1x to 16x kind, otherwise the mobo will not detect the card. From the gist of the thread it seems this is due to the design of the extenders themselves - something to do with a pin that should not be there due to it messing the hotswap capability of PCIe.

So my question is, has anyone had any issues with the 1x to 16x extenders on their motherboard. Have you had to try any funky tricks like shorting pins on the extenders themselves to get the card to be recognized (once again when using JUST the 1x to 16x).

Post by: ssateneth on January 25, 2014, 02:41:37 AM
International first class and small flat rate priority shipping often does not have tracking once it leaves the USA. It will not have a scan showing it left the USA either. The only guarantee for tracking internationally is USPS Express International, or EMS.

Also, there is a small list of countries that supposedly have tracking available for first class int'l and small FR priority packages. Not sure what they are though. I'm sure googling it will turn up a result. It should be understood before conducting a trade if the shipping service is at the buyers risk, or if the seller will offer compensation, though in that scenario, the seller won't know if the buyer is lying or not. Thats why I highly recommended Express shipping internationally since it protects both me and the buyer, and priority or first class is entirely at the buyers risk.
